 Finding Enlightenment in Scotland

 

    In the 1740sthe famous French philosophy Voltaire said We look to Scotland for all our ideas of civilization.Thats not a bad advertisement for any countryespecially when it comes to attracting people in search of a first class education~

   Yet some people go even further than that.According to the American author Arthur Hermanthe Scots invented the modem world itself.He argues that Scottish thinkers and intellectuals worked out many of the most important ideas on which modem life depends-everything from the scientific method to market economics.Their ideas did not just spread amongst intellectualsbut to those people in businessgovernment and the sciences who actually shaped the Western world.

    It all started during the period that historians call the Scottish Enlightenmentwhich is usually seen as taking place between the years 1740 and 1800.At this timeScotland was home to a number of thinkers who made an important shift in the course of Western philosophy.Before thatphilosophy was mainly concerned with religion.For the thinkers of the Scottish Enlightenmentthe proper study of humanity was mankind itself.

   Their reasoning was practical.For the philosopher David Humehumanity was the right subject for philosophy because we can examine human behavior and so find real evidence of how people think and feel.And from that we can make judgements about the societies we live in and make concrete suggestions about how they can be improvedfor universal benefit.

    Hume was not a scientist himselfbut his enquiry into the nature of knowledge laid the foundations for the scientific method-the pursuit of truth through experiment.His friend and fellow resident of EdinburghAdam Smithfamously applied the study of mankind to the ways in which mankind does business.Tradehe arguedwas a form of information.Money is the way in which people tell each other what they wantand how much people pay is the best way we have of knowing how much somebody wants something.In pursuing our own interests through trading in marketswe all come to benefit each other.

    Smiths idea of enlightened self-interesthas come to dominate modem views of economics.It also has wider applications.He was one of the first major philosophers to point out that nations can become richfree and powerful more efficiently through peacetrade and invention than by means of war and plunder.

    The original Scottish Enlightenment is thought to have ended with the lives of SmithHume and the other thinkers who lived in Scotland at that time.But a wider Scottish Enlightenment can still be seen.It exists in the way that the ideas evolved at that time still underpin our theories.It also exists in Scotland itself in an educational tradition that combines academic excellence with practical orientation.
